Lifting Belts...When do you use them?
BODYBUILDING SUPPLEMENTS High Quality Supplements For Bodybuilders and Athletes. www.ironmaglabs.com G'day guys and girls...
Just wondering how often everyone here uses Lifting belts... I've read and heard a lot of contradicting views on this topic...Some people say only use with heavy Squats/deadlifts while others will take it a step further and use them when performing others like standing Barbell curls, bench press etc... Personally I find it better to just use proper form when performing squats to bring in stabilizers and haven't had any issues to date... Intrested in other peoples views |

I don't use them. However, I'm not against using them for big structural compound movements at higher intensities. If you want to strap one on for a 3RM squat, I won't hold it against you. If you wear them for your 15 reps curls, then stop.

I've used them for squats and deadlifts on 5 or less rep sets. But I have done way more 5 or less rep sets without a belt than I have with. Generally, I try not to use it as much as possible. I will on a rare occasion, usually when going for a very heavy PR. I still try to keep in my mind how much I can do with and without a belt on any given movement.

I read an article over on T-Nation that simply stated that everyone has a structural limit of how much their spine can take. When you exceed this limit, you'll injure, and re-injure, yourself. The article made sense. So, if I should reach that point, it's either time to back off or get some help in the form a belt. But, until then, I'll go belt-less.
